Change since 2011 is not available for this village.
The 2020 Mission Antyodaya survey recorded a population of 636
— exactly the Census 2011 figure. That happens in about 15% of villages
nationally, where the surveyor appears to have carried the old number forward
rather than counting afresh. Showing “0% growth” here would be
reporting a number nobody measured, so we don't.

Gram panchayat finances, 2024–25
XV Finance Commission grant for
Pratappura panchayat, Vav zila parishad.
These are the panchayat's own accounts, not this village's: where a panchayat
holds several villages, the money covers all of them, and where a village
spans several panchayats only this one's return appears.
Opening balance
₹18.03 lakh
Received from state (auto-transfer)
₹7.34 lakh
Received directly
₹13.00 lakh
Spent
₹27.33 lakh
Unspent at year end
₹11.03 lakh
Untied (basic grant)
opened ₹12.18 lakh · received ₹2.94 lakh · spent ₹13.25 lakh · left ₹6.87 lakh
Tied (earmarked)
opened ₹5.84 lakh · received ₹4.40 lakh · spent ₹14.08 lakh · left ₹4.16 lakh
Source: eGramSwaraj, as reported by the panchayat. Untied and tied
together make up the totals above.
